Nottingham law firm to open Lincoln office

Fraser Brown's new offices in Lincoln

Law firm Fraser Brown has announced that it is opening an office in Lincoln this April, making it the firm’s second city to its HQ in Nottingham.

Fraser Brown, which has a team of 120 professionals across three offices in Nottinghamshire, has taken the self-contained office on Kingsley Office Park on the south west side of Lincoln.

The law firm says it is working with a number of Lincolnshire-based businesses and had been looking for offices for a number of months. The new office will offer commercial and private client services including corporate law and real estate.

Initially the Lincoln team includes five full-time legal staff with supporting teams and the practice hopes to grow that organically over the coming 12-18 months. It is currently recruiting to expand the offering for its corporate, commercial and residential property departments in Lincoln.

The Lincoln office was secured on behalf of Fraser Brown by Nottingham-based Commercial Property Partners (CPP) with Lincoln-based Pygott & Crone working on behalf of the landlord.
